NVIDIA Tesla V100 PCIe 16 GB vs AMD Radeon Instinct MI250X

We compared two Professional market GPUs: 16GB VRAM Tesla V100 PCIe 16 GB and 128GB VRAM Radeon Instinct MI250X to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A Tesla V100 PCIe 16 GB 's Advantages
Lower TDP (300W vs 500W)
AMD Radeon Instinct MI250X 's Advantages
Released 4 years and 5 months late
Boost Clock has increased by 23% (1700MHz vs 1380MHz)
More VRAM (128GB vs 16GB)
Larger VRAM bandwidth (3277GB/s vs 897.0GB/s)
8960 additional rendering cores
